+ /*
+ * If the 'label' property is not present for the AT24 EEPROM,
+ * then nvmem_config.id is initialised to NVMEM_DEVID_AUTO,
+ * and this will append the 'devid' to the name of the NVMEM
+ * device. This is purely legacy and the AT24 driver has always
+ * defaulted to this. However, if the 'label' property is
+ * present then this means that the name is specified by the
+ * firmware and this name should be used verbatim and so it is
+ * not necessary to append the 'devid'.
+ */
+ if (device_property_present(dev, "label")) {
+ nvmem_config.id = NVMEM_DEVID_NONE;
+ err = device_property_read_string(dev, "label",
+ &nvmem_config.name);
+ if (err)
+ return err;
+ } else {
+ nvmem_config.id = NVMEM_DEVID_AUTO;
+ nvmem_config.name = dev_name(dev);
+ }
